Default Key chain camera/size of rocket

What is the smallest rocket you would mount one of these key chain cameras to?
I Don't want to throw a rocket so out of balance that it arcs bad.

Where would you mount the camera, just under the nose cone, middle, or way down low between the fins?
My guess would be up top.

I'm thinking BT-55 or BT-60 would be the smallest I'd try. So far, I've always mounted my camera just under the nose cone. It's the spot where a payload section would be, so I figure someone who actually understood the forces at work already did the figuring for me.

Leo has flown his on one of the little ARTF Army Patriots. That's the kit that's based on the old ARTF Dagger and Bandit kits from the mid 90's. IIRC they are about 1" in diameter.

I'd put it at least a little in front of the CG.
